Global Validation, Calibration and Standardization in Life Sciences Market to Reach $3.9 Billion by 2030, Fueled by Regulatory Demands and Digital Transformation
The global market for validation, calibration, and standardization in life sciences is on track to expand from $2.7 billion in 2024 to $3.9 billion by 2030, with a compound annual growth rate (CAGR) of 6.7%, according to a recent report from BCC Research. This growth is attributed to increasing regulatory compliance demands, the rise of complex biologics and advanced therapy medicinal products (ATMPs), and the ongoing digital transformation within the life sciences sector.
The report highlights that North America holds a dominant 40.5% market share, driven by its stringent FDA regulations and a robust pharmaceutical manufacturing base. The complexity of modern therapies, such as cell and gene therapies and monoclonal antibodies, necessitates more rigorous validation protocols compared to traditional small-molecule drugs, thereby expanding the market. Furthermore, the integration of AI-driven validation platforms, IoT-enabled calibration systems, and cloud-based compliance solutions is revolutionizing validation practices, replacing outdated paper-based systems and enhancing operational efficiency.
